Output 81bf21502f5a82c5ebec4adcfcde498e11bae8737e7d6a5725cc74451675f727:4

value
684725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bc1c2bf5d1870f37c03745dfd97d9c11e8ad2c OP_EQUAL
address
3Fhtf1UGhfjSbBLBXFZQfiCpZWuRV3Hbdb
transaction
81bf21502f5a82c5ebec4adcfcde498e11bae8737e7d6a5725cc74451675f727
spent
true